WATER RESOURCES CONTROL BOARD, STATE

Title:  SPECIAL INVESTIGATOR I (NON-PEACE OFFICER)
Salary: $3,902.00 - $5,363.00
Posted: 04/08/2010

Job Description:
The Division of Water Rights (Division) has an opening for four permanent full-time, Special Investigator I (non-peace office) to work in the AB2121 Unit for the Division of Water Rights. Headquarters for this position is at the North Coast Regional Water Quality Control Board, located in Santa Rosa, California. Duties: Under the direction of a Supervising Special Investigator in the Enforcement Section for Water Rights, the incumbent will conduct or participate in field inspections of water diversion facilities to detect or verify suspected violations of water right laws, rules, or regulations. Incumbent will interview water diverters, gather evidence, review water right records, and other available pertinent information to complete a detailed inspection report recommending appropriate action. Incumbent will team with environmental scientists, water resources control engineers and other agency specialists on joint investigations to protect public trust resources. Incumbent will also help maintain database records, answer public inquiries and other duties as needed. Necessary Qualifications: Candidates must be in the classification of Special Investigator I (Non-Peace Officer) or have list, transfer or reinstatement eligibility to the class. Desirable Qualifications: Good communication and technical writing skills; Familiar with Microsoft Office software and GIS application; Willingness to travel and work irregular hours in various locations throughout the State; provide testimony of observed facts for prosecution of violators of laws, regulations, or terms and conditions of permits and agreements; Some basic knowledge of California’s water right system and the State Water Board’s authority; Enforcement activities of National Marine Fishery Services and/or Department of Fish and Game, as they relate to water diversion.
